I'd prefer that my Texas driver record stay clear, and I want to take an internet defensive driving program soon. How does GetDefensive.com’s defensive driving internet class work?
GetDefensive.com offers two (2) types of online defensive driving classes - one is for ticket dismissal and the other is for auto insurance premium reduction. You may finish GetDefensive.com’s online defensive driving course on any computer with online access. You are free to start and stop as often as necessary, and then resume from wherever you left off. The internet defensive driving class is divided into several chapters, and at the end of each chapter you will be given a short, multiple-choice quiz which will help you in preparing for the final exam. When you successfully finish the final exam, GetDefensive.com will present to you a completion certificate which will be sent to you via the shipping method that you pick at registration.

I would like to keep my recent traffic citation off of my Texas driver record. What are the eligibility requirements for completing GetDefensive.com’s defensive driving internet course?
State Law in Texas prohibits you from dismissing a second traffic ticket every twelve (12) months. If you are not certain when you last successfully went through the online defensive driving class, we urge that you check with the traffic court to find out if you currently are eligible to finish GetDefensive.com's defensive driving online class.
I recently got another traffic ticket this year, and I have to keep my Texas driver record clear. Do the quizzes count toward my overall grade in the GetDefensive.com defensive driving online course?
There is a short quiz after each chapter in GetDefensive.com’s defensive driving internet program. The quizzes are essential and help in preparing you for the defensive driving final exam, but they will not count against your overall grade in the internet defensive driving program.
